Throwdown for a cause to take place in Ventnor
Last Updated on Wednesday, March 13, 2013 11:15 pm Written by SHAUN SMITH Sunday, March 17, 2013 01:00 am
VENTNOR – Whatcha gonna do brother, when professional wrestling comes to a venue near you?
No, it’s not Hulk Hogan. The Bodyslam Wrestling Organization will present a full card of professional wrestling to benefit Ventnor City Policeman’s Benevolent Association Local 97 Saturday, March 23 at the Ventnor Educational Community Complex.
Billed as “From the Ashes,” the event will feature Ventnor native Anthony Graves and a heavyweight bout between champion Tristen Law and Rhett Titus.
Delirious is set to square off against Preacher, Terra Callaway will face Arlene, and Grizzly Redwood will try to take down Ray Ray Marz. Steve Off, Magic Mike Capp and ECP will also make appearances.
According to PBA President David Gaeckle, the union donates its time and money to local organizations like Ventnor Little League, Ventnor Pirates football and the Ventnor Home and School Association. The group also sponsors events such as National Night Out and the annual barbecue for eighth-graders.
“Because we are a nonprofit organization we depend on our fundraising, and with those funds we can give assistance to the community,” Gaeckle said Wednesday. “Recently we helped several families in the community that were affected by Hurricane Sandy.”
He said the organization has provided monetary assistance to families and plans to assist with rebuilding efforts.
Events such as next weekend’s wrestling help the organization fund community projects – and Gaeckle anticipates that it will be a night of high entertainment.
“It is kind of a unique thing to have in the area,” Gaeckle said. “It’s going to be pretty exciting.”
Doors open 6:30 p.m. Saturday at the VECC, 400 N. Lafayette Ave. The first match is scheduled for 7 p.m. Tickets are $10 in advance or $12 at the door. Snacks, soda and water will be available during the show in the cafeteria.
